Can';t似乎无法从PHP date()中转义字符;
我试图使日期相等,比如:2013年8月5日下午6:55发布。然而,我似乎无法正确地完成“on”部分的工作。我尝试过反斜杠我想要的字符,但每次都会发生类似的事情:Can';t似乎无法从PHP date()中转义字符;,php,date,escaping,Php,Date,Escaping,我试图使日期相等,比如:2013年8月5日下午6:55发布。然而,我似乎无法正确地完成“on”部分的工作。我尝试过反斜杠我想要的字符,但每次都会发生类似的事情:06:55 PM o 8/5/13 我似乎无法让“n”出现 这就是我所拥有的: date("h:i A \o\n m/d/y"); 根据php手册网站,这应该是可行的。帮帮我?谢谢。PHP将把\n解释为换行符。要避免这种情况,只需添加一个额外的斜杠: date("h:i A \o\\n m/d/y"); 产出: 04:06 AM on
06:55 PM o 8/5/13
我似乎无法让“n”出现
这就是我所拥有的:
date("h:i A \o\n m/d/y");
根据php手册网站,这应该是可行的。帮帮我?谢谢。PHP将把
\n
解释为换行符。要避免这种情况,只需添加一个额外的斜杠:
date("h:i A \o\\n m/d/y");
产出:
04:06 AM on 08/06/13
现场演示:您也可以使用单引号来避免转义:
echo date('h:i A \o\n m/d/y');